The Order of Malta mourns the death of Prince Ranieri

06/04/2005

The Prince and Grand Master of the Order of Malta Fra’ Andrew Bertie has expressed his grief at the news of the death of H.S.H. Prince Ranieri III of Monaco.

The Grand Master and all the members of the Order offer their heartfelt condolences to the prince’s family, so deeply affected by the loss of the sovereign who has led the Principality of Monaco since 1949 with such great commitment and dedication.

Prince Ranieri has been a member of the Order of Malta since 1956 with the rank of Bailiff Grand Cross of Honour and Devotion. In 1997 he received the Cross of Profession ad honorem, one of the Order’s highest honours.

The Grand Master has sent a telegram of condolence to Prince Albert.
